The explanation has been given. He was reporting a numbers station heard on
Hamsphere. Not a real transmission, but a recording that is played on the
ham radio "simulation" of Hamshpere. No actual radio transmitters,
receivers, or antennas, are actually part of the Hamsphere simulation.
To answer your question, it is the "real thing" in that it is a real
recording of LP, however it is a recording made years ago, not a new signal
actually transmitted over air today. You can hear it almost non-stop on one
frequency or another on Hamsphere.
